The correct option is this: A PATIENT GOES FOR CHEMOTHERAPY TREATMENT TO TREAT CANCER.
There are three classes of prevention strategies in the medical field, these include: primary, secondary and tertiary prevention. The tertiary level of prevention refers to the interventions that are designed to arrest the progress of an established disease and to control its negative consequences.
